Preguntas frecuentes sobre Garfield Heights
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Garfield Heights?
Actualmente hay 103 Apartamentos Estudios en Garfield Heights con alquileres que van desde $900 hasta $1,618, con un precio medio de $1,216.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Garfield Heights?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Garfield Heights varian entre $825 y $2,065 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,454
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Garfield Heights?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Garfield Heights van desde $1,100 hasta $3,163.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,680
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Garfield Heights?
En estos momentos hay 70 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Garfield Heights en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$900 y $2,925 - con una media de $1,921 para el lugar.
